dymax fan is noisy for me. the best non-noisy type is those square shape normal looking fan. those fancy looking fan, (dymax, gex etc) are generally more noisy. (i have tried all the models that i stated in this reply)
however, be prepared that fan no matter what will produce certain level of sound.
one thing to note, testing for the level of sound at seaview may look as if its quiet, but back at home at night i will be noisy, as the ambience noise level is different.

From what I remember, Sunon is a brand of PC cooling fans. DIY-ing a set of cooling fans using PC cooling fans + some cheap add-ons is a good option for those who are cash strapped. The ready-made fans look nice aesthetically, but they are essentially doing the same job as a DIY set of fans.

As stated in this thread, the prices for fans are variable depending on brands and size and thus unreliable for a person to decide his/her purchase on. 2nd hand fans, or DIY PC cooling fans can perform the same job for a much lower price if the aquarist is not concerned about how it looks or the capability of the fan. A simple DIY PC cooling fan unit from those 2nd hand stores at Sim Lim Square with a power adapter can cost less than $20 to rig up.
From user reviews, the GEX fan loses to the Mr Aqua Tornado fan in terms of cooling capability. The cost difference is not much between the two as far as I recall. GEX is Made in Taiwan, going by my smaller model's box, and Mr Aqua, probably Made in China. The country of origin does not denote the quality of the item.
